    I don't mean to be a buzz kill at ALL because I want to stress that each and every person's journey is different- but I used Noxin shampoo, biotin supplements, and got at least 60g of protein EVERY DAY after my clear liquid diet was finished 2 weeks post op. I still lost about half of the volume of my hair between months 3 and 5. After month 5 the loss stopped completely and now I have significant re-growth coming in. I discussed this at length with my doctor who said that taking supplements and using shampoos can not hurt, and in some instances they do help, but loss WILL happen if its going to happen and its just an unfortunate reality that comes along with the healthy lifestyle the sleeve allows us for the rest of our lives. There's not much we can do to stop it.

    i post this on every hair loss thread....

    telogen effluvium

    there is NOTHING you can do to prevent the loss. if you are one of the large percent that it happens to, you did nothing wrong. It happens for the same reason many women restart their periods the day of surgery. Our internal clocks restart, a percentage of the hair jumps into the loss phase, and bam within three or four months, all those hairs fall. period. you can help with the regrowth though with supplements, protein and biotin etc. but you can't STOP the loss.
